Spintronics is an emerging technology exploiting the spin degree of
freedom and has proved to be very promising for new types of fast
electronic devices. Amongst the anticipated advantages of
spintronics technologies, researchers have identified the
non-volatile storage of data with high density and low energy
consumption as particularly relevant. This monograph examines the
concept of half-metallic compounds perspectives to obtain novel
solutions and discusses several oxides such as perovskites, double
perovskites and CrO2 as well as Heusler compounds. Such materials
can be designed and made with high spin polarization and,
especially in the case of Heusler compounds, many material-related
problems present in current-day 3d metal systems, can be overcome.
Spintronics: From Materials to Devices provides an insight into the
current research on Heusler compounds and offers a general
understanding of structure-property relationships, including the
influence of disorder and correlations on the electronic structure
and interfaces. Spintronics devices such as magnetic tunnel
junctions (MTJs) and giant magnetoresistance (GMR) devices, with
current perpendicular to the plane, in which Co2 based Heusler
compounds are used as new electrode materials, are also introduced.
From materials design by theoretical methods and the preparation
and properties of the materials to the production of thin films and
devices, this monograph represents a valuable guide to both novices
and experts in the fields of Chemistry, Physics, and Materials
Science.
